IDC's Database Management and Data Integration Software service presents a strategic view of IT information management strategies and approaches. Through this research, product, marketing, and strategic planning professionals gain essential market intelligence on database management systems (DBMS), data integration software, master data management software, and database administration (DBA) tools and utilities.
Markets and Subjects Analyzed
Enterprise database management systems
Data integration software and its role in business intelligence, master data management (MDM), and data governance
Tools and utilities for database development, tuning, and maintenance
Memory-based DBMS vendors and products and the rise of memory-based technology in mainstream RDBMS
The embedded DBMS channel and its growing significance
Data quality, data replication, and extract, transform, and load (ETL) tools
Big Data–related products and vendors, both supporting MapReduce/Hadoop and other Big Data areas such as graph database
Challenges and opportunities for data management in cloud computing, open source software, and others

Companies Analyzed
IDC's Database Management and Data Integration Software service examines the strategies, market positioning, and future direction of major vendors in the database management and data integration software market, including:
BMC, Bradmark, CA Technologies, Couchbase, Compuware, Embarcadero, EMC (Greenplum), EnterpriseDB, ETI, Experian QAS, Hitachi, HP (Vertica), IBM, Informatica, InterSystems, iWay Software (subsidiary of IBI), MetaMatrix (subsidiary of Red Hat), Microsoft, Objectivity, Oracle (including MySQL), ParAccel, Pervasive, Pitney-Bowes Business Insights, Quest, SAP (including BusinessObjects and Sybase), SAS Institute (including DataFlux), SchemaLogic, Software AG, Talend, Teradata, TIBCO, Versant, Vision Solutions, and VoltDB.
